Synopsis

Germs are everywhere, as this fascinating overview of the subject explains. Some germs are harmful, causing debilitating diseases, while others are beneficial, helping humans and animals to digest food. Covered is the discovery of germs, how some cause disease, how others aid living things, and how various industries have learned to use some germs to improve the quality of human life and communities.

From Booklist

Reviewed with P. M. Boekhoff and Stuart Kallen's Lasers.

Gr. 4-5. These two titles in the KidHaven Science Library series offer wide-angle overviews of their topics. Nardo defines germs in the broadest possible way, including not only viruses and bacteria but also protozoans, microscopic fungi, and even algae; he emphasizes that, while many of these engender diseases, most are harmless or even beneficial to humans. Boekhoff and Kallen discuss lasers from Einstein's description of their basic principles to today's pervasive devices, tallying their uses in medicine, recreation, military endeavors, and heavy and fine industry. The color photos in the volumes are more decorative than enlightening, but both books close with lists of recent resources, and Lasers cites a (commercial) Web site, too. The level of detail in Germs makes it a good follow-up to Melvin Berger's Germs Make Me Sick! (1995), and Lasers is an acceptable alternative or companion for several titles currently in print. John Peters
